  • punch-drunk syndrome — a group of symptoms consisting of progressive dementia, tremor of the hands, and epilepsy. It is a consequence of repeated blows to the head that have been severe enough to cause concussion …   Medical dictionary

  • punch-drunk syndrome — a group of symptoms consisting of progressive dementia, tremor of the hands, epilepsy, and parkinsonism. It is a consequence of repeated blows to the head that have been severe enough to cause concussion …   The new mediacal dictionary
